On Friday, November 13, 2015, Palestinian terrorists shot to death Rabbi Ya'akov Litman, 40, and his son Netanel, 18, in front of other family members while driving near Hebron.
On Monday, November 16, 2015, UN Human Rights Council special rapporteur on the human rights in the "occupied Palestinian territories," Makarim Wibisono, and special rapporteur on summary executions, Christof Heyns, issued a press release slandering Israel with the accusation of "executing" Palestinians while describing the murder of Rabbi Litman and Netanel Litman this way: "Further fatalities, Israeli and Palestinian, were reported last Friday and over the weekend."
